D: [iurt_root_command] chroot Installing /home/pterjan/rpmbuild/SRPMS/ruby-mysql-2.9.1-12.mga7.src.rpm Executing(%prep): /bin/sh -e /home/pterjan/rpmbuild/tmp/rpm-tmp.fHAAmU + umask 022 + cd /home/pterjan/rpmbuild/BUILD + '[' 1 -eq 1 ']' + '[' 1 -eq 1 ']' + '[' 1 -eq 1 ']' + cd /home/pterjan/rpmbuild/BUILD + rm -rf mysql-2.9.1 + /usr/bin/gem unpack /home/pterjan/rpmbuild/SOURCES/mysql-2.9.1.gem Unpacked gem: '/home/pterjan/rpmbuild/BUILD/mysql-2.9.1' + /usr/bin/gem spec /home/pterjan/rpmbuild/SOURCES/mysql-2.9.1.gem --ruby + STATUS=0 + '[' 0 -ne 0 ']' + cd mysql-2.9.1 + /usr/bin/chmod -Rf a+rX,u+w,g-w,o-w . + echo 'Patch #0 (mysql-2.9.1-mariadb.patch):' Patch #0 (mysql-2.9.1-mariadb.patch): + /usr/bin/patch --no-backup-if-mismatch -p0 --fuzz=0 patching file test/test_mysql.rb + exit 0 Executing(%build): /bin/sh -e /home/pterjan/rpmbuild/tmp/rpm-tmp.Up3WiS + umask 022 + cd /home/pterjan/rpmbuild/BUILD + cd mysql-2.9.1 + '[' 1 -eq 1 ']' + '[' 1 -eq 1 ']' + /usr/bin/gem build ../mysql-2.9.1.gemspec WARNING: licenses is empty, but is recommended. Use a license identifier from http://spdx.org/licenses or 'Nonstandard' for a nonstandard license. WARNING: See http://guides.rubygems.org/specification-reference/ for help Successfully built RubyGem Name: mysql Version: 2.9.1 File: mysql-2.9.1.gem + /usr/bin/gem install mysql-2.9.1.gem -V --local --env-shebang --rdoc --ri --force --ignore-dependencies --install-dir /usr/share/gems --bindir /usr/bin --build-root . WARNING: You build with buildroot. Build root: /home/pterjan/rpmbuild/BUILD/mysql-2.9.1 Bin dir: /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/bin Gem home: /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/.gemtest /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/COPYING /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/COPYING.ja /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/History.txt /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/Manifest.txt /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/README.txt /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/Rakefile /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/ext/mysql_api/extconf.rb /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/ext/mysql_api/mysql.c /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/extra/README.html /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/extra/README_ja.html /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/extra/tommy.css /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/lib/mysql.rb /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/lib/mysql/version.rb /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/tasks/gem.rake /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/tasks/native.rake /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/tasks/vendor_mysql.rake /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/test/test_mysql.rb Building native extensions. This could take a while... current directory: /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/ext/mysql_api /usr/bin/ruby -r ./siteconf20171004-23028-1akyn3i.rb extconf.rb checking for mysql_ssl_set()... yes checking for rb_str_set_len()... yes checking for rb_thread_start_timer()... no checking for mysql.h... yes creating Makefile current directory: /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/ext/mysql_api make "DESTDIR=" clean rm -f rm -f mysql_api.so *.o *.bak mkmf.log .*.time current directory: /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1/ext/mysql_api make "DESTDIR=" gcc -I. -I/usr/include -I/usr/include/ruby/backward -I/usr/include -I. -DHAVE_MYSQL_SSL_SET -DHAVE_RB_STR_SET_LEN -DHAVE_MYSQL_H -I/usr/include/mysql -I/usr/include/mysql/.. -fPIC -O2 -g -pipe -Wformat -Werror=format-security -Wp,-D_FORTIFY_SOURCE=2 -fstack-protector --param=ssp-buffer-size=4 -fPIC -o mysql.o -c mysql.c mysql.c: In function 'stmt_bind_result': mysql.c:1320:74: error: 'rb_cFixnum' undeclared (first use in this function); did you mean 'rb_isalnum'? else if (argv[i] == rb_cNumeric || argv[i] == rb_cInteger || argv[i] == rb_cFixnum) ^~~~~~~~~~ rb_isalnum mysql.c:1320:74: note: each undeclared identifier is reported only once for each function it appears in make: *** [Makefile:243: mysql.o] Error 1 ERROR: Error installing mysql-2.9.1.gem: ERROR: Failed to build gem native extension. Building has failed. See above output for more information on the failure. make failed, exit code 2 Gem files will remain installed in /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/share/gems/gems/mysql-2.9.1 for inspection. Results logged to /home/pterjan/rpmbuild/BUILD/mysql-2.9.1/usr/lib64/gems/ruby/mysql-2.9.1/gem_make.out error: Bad exit status from /home/pterjan/rpmbuild/tmp/rpm-tmp.Up3WiS (%build) RPM build errors: Bad exit status from /home/pterjan/rpmbuild/tmp/rpm-tmp.Up3WiS (%build) I: [iurt_root_command] ERROR: chroot